こんにちは、Habr!
9月16日と17日に、モスクワはOpen Fights Codility hackathonを開催します。 これはディスカバリーの友人によって組織されており、Redmadrobotはモバイルの方向を監視し、チームを支援し、審査員の1人として評価します。
最初のオンライン段階では、銀行の小売顧客向けのクールなソリューションを考え出す必要があります。 それは、銀行のアシスタント、自動請求ツール、またはまったく別のものである可能性があります。 主な条件は、アプリケーションがクライアントの問題を解決し、銀行の製品との相互作用を改善することです。
GitHubで最高のアイデアとプロファイルを持つチームは、ワークステーションに2日間の集中的なハッカソンに参加し、提案された言語の1つとシークレットバンクAPIを使用して、実際に動作するモバイルアプリケーションまたはWebアプリケーションアプリケーションを独自の方法で作成します。
審査員は、アイデアの品質と拡張性、コードの品質、選択したアーキテクチャについてプロジェクトを評価します。
賞品
すべての参加者は、Otkrytieの開発者とモバイルバンキングおよびインターネットバンキング部門の責任者と、業界の専門家との非公式なコミュニケーションを行います( グローバルファイナンス2017で最初の3位を獲得し、他のさまざまな賞を受賞しました)。 Redmadrobotの開発者と幹部(このような人のことを聞いたことがないのなら、これらは今年4つの評価を獲得している人たちです)と業界の他の価値ある代表者です。
受賞者には、当社、Netologia、Workstation、Electronic Cloud、JetBrains、およびその他のハッカソンパートナーから賞品が贈られます。 そして、もちろん、Otkrytieからの賞金は最高を待っています-150,000ルーブル、2番目に150,000ルーブル、3番目に100,000ルーブル。
ツール
参加者は幅広い言語のスタックで作業し、銀行のシークレットAPIにアクセスします。
次の言語から選択できます。
- スイフト
- コトリン
- Python
- Php
- Java
- Node.js
- Javascript
- .NET
- Ruby on Rails
API:
- IB / MB請求書(電子請求書発行)
- ジオコーディング(最も近いATMおよびブランチの決定)
- 為替レートを取得する
- カード製品のデータの受信(トランザクションのリスト、現在の残高、レート)
- すべての預金に関する情報
- 現金ローンの利用規約
ハッカソンのメンバーになる方法
単独またはペアで参加できます。 必要なのは:
- 優れた開発者である(たとえば、GitHubのプロファイルで証明する)
- 興味深いアイデアを思いつきます(アプリケーションで簡単に説明してください)
- サイトに登録(締め切り-9月8日)